How Can I Describe Salvation

How can I describe Salvation
From a personal point of view
It's a change from the inside out
That only God can do
Our enemy called sin
Has such penetrating power
Particularly blinding us to our need
Of Salvation in this hour

The gospel is hid to those who are lost
So the Bible says
And Satan has blinded each person's eyes
To prevent them from being saved
But praise God by His drawing power
He leads by His Spirit to believe
And every single seeking soul
Upon repentance will receive

So great Salvation in Christ the Lord
This is a gift from God
Bestowed upon each believing heart
As a token of His love
And Jesus death upon the cross
Procured a resolution
For for the penalty of my sin
He became sin's substitution

And offered up His life as such
The Lamb for sinner's slain
So Salvation by grace through faith alone
Could be literally obtained
I have been changed from the inside out
And Christ now lives in me
I came... I saw... I repented... I believed
Praise God for Calvary!

About the Poet
I came to know the Lord as my personal Saviour in January of 1972. I was married on Oct 21,1966 to my wife Linda who also loves the Lord. We have ten children and now twenty-four grand children. In Aug 2012 we got the announcement of the birth of our first GREAT grand child (a baby girl). I was thrilled to find others of like precious faith and belief in Jesus Christ. Hallelujah! What a Savior! I am presently living in Champion, Alberta, Canada but we are originally from Sault Ste. Marie, Ontario, Canada. That is where the poem Canadian Tribute to America was birthed. One Sunday as I walked across the city on my way to church I came to the top of a hill and looked across at Sault Ste. Marie, Michigan. After watching the events of the Sept 11 tragedy it was weighing on my heart and mind and the Lord gave me these words. We came to Calgary and when my oldest daughter saw this poem she said, �Dad, what�s this?� and I said a poem and she replied �Dad, that�s not a poem , that�s a song� and she then went to the piano and began to sing and play it.
